Music Staff: Marilyn and Brad Short

Marilyn Short has been the Music Director since 2006, having served as the organist and choir accompanist since 1999. A member of the American Guild of Organists, Marilyn is also the staff choral accompanist at Webster Groves High School. Marilyn has accounting degrees from Kansas State University.



Brad Short began directing the Second Baptist Church choir in 2006. He is a long-time church musician who first started singing alongside his mother as a soprano. He is also the music librarian at Washington University. Brad has music degrees from Kansas State University and the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ill.
